The Anatomy of a Fort Adams Speed Dating Evening

Let's demystify the process. You arrive, perhaps with a slight, excited nervousness, and are greeted by a friendly host. You check in, receive a name tag and a scorecard, and are welcomed into a designated, comfortable space within the fort—perhaps an officer's hall or a special event room with views of the bay. The atmosphere is intentionally curated to be warm, welcoming, and upscale casual.

The format is elegantly simple. Participants are divided, and over a series of short "dates," typically 5-7 minutes each, you have a one-on-one conversation with each person of the opposite sex. A bell or gentle signal marks the end of each mini-date. In that brief window, magic can happen. You quickly learn to articulate who you are, what you enjoy, and what you're looking for. You discover an ability to listen intently and read social cues. The pressure of carrying a whole evening on a single conversation is gone. It's a series of fresh starts.

After each conversation, you make a note on your card: "yes" if you'd be interested in seeing that person again, or "no" if you feel it wasn't a match. This is the core of its efficiency. There is no ambiguity, no waiting for a text that never comes. If you both mark "yes" for each other, the organizers facilitate a mutual introduction via email after the event. The connection is confirmed, the interest is mutual, and you can proceed to plan a proper first date—perhaps a walk along the Fort Adams Bay Walk or a coffee in downtown Newport—with a foundation already built.

The Unrivaled Benefits: Why This Format Wins

Compared to the alternatives, the benefits of speed dating at Fort Adams are profound.

  • Time Efficiency: In roughly two hours, you meet 15-20 potential matches. This would take weeks, if not months, to replicate through apps or chance encounters.
  • Safety and Vetting: Everyone is there for the same purpose. The environment is controlled and public, eliminating the uncertainties of meeting a stranger from an app alone for the first time.
  • Immediate Feedback and Body Language: You experience the person's energy, their smile, their laugh, and their conversational style. These are the irreplaceable elements of chemistry that a profile picture can never convey.
  • A Break from Rejection Culture: The "no" is silent, private, and painless. You are not publicly dismissed or ignored. This creates a remarkably positive and low-pressure atmosphere.
  • Practice Makes Perfect: It's an incredible way to hone your social and conversational skills. Each bell is a reset, a chance to refine your approach and become more authentically yourself.
